  • 2.0

    VVTerm 2.0 brings Files over SFTP to iPhone, iPad, and Mac. Browse remote directories, preview files, upload and download, create folders, rename, move, delete, and edit text files inline.

  • 2.1

    VVTerm 2.1 improves Remote Files, terminal input, and cross-device reliability. Remote Files now supports tabs, remembers browser state, and includes refined previews, toolbars, notices, and file actions. Remote directory operations are also more reliable, including deletion of non-empty folders. Terminal input is smoother across iOS and macOS, with better hardware keyboard and IME handling, improved text selection and find behavior, inline IME preedit on macOS, and stronger remote terminal compatibility with xterm-ghostty support. This update also adds Korean localization, improves Cloudflare Access translations, and makes sync recovery and onboarding more resilient.

  • 2.2

    VVTerm 2.2 focuses on terminal reliability and day-to-day workflow polish. • Improved iPhone and iPad terminal input, including hardware keyboard + IME handling, software Backspace repeat, text selection focus, and trackpad scrolling. • Improved Mosh and remote terminal startup with CJK/IME input fixes and better xterm-ghostty compatibility. • Added SSH host key re-trust recovery and macOS controls for deleting saved SSH keys. • Better Windows shell detection that respects pwsh when it is the default shell. • Polished Remote Files tabs, hidden-keyboard controls, Pro upgrade screens, and localization details.

  • 2.3

    VVTerm 2.3 makes the terminal feel smoother in daily use. You can now zoom terminal panes and adjust cursor controls more easily, with better zoom indicator placement on iOS. tmux support is improved for Windows hosts, tab titles now follow runtime changes, and the voice recording UI has been polished. This update also fixes working directory reuse between servers and includes smaller reliability and UI improvements.

  • 2.4

    Version 2.4 refreshes VVTerm across Mac, iPhone, and iPad. • New native macOS connection toolbar and improved tab strip. • Cleaner macOS sidebar, file-tab empty state, and Liquid Glass/soft-edge polish. • Better iOS accessory arrow-key handling and empty workspace flow. • Improved tmux title handling and PowerShell working directory restore.

  • 2.5

    Version 2.5 makes VVTerm more useful and reliable across Mac, iPhone, and iPad. • A richer, customizable server stats dashboard, now with Docker monitoring. • Better keyboard controls, including separate left and right Option-as-Alt settings on iPhone and iPad, Option-as-Alt on Mac, and an option to keep the terminal size steady when the iOS keyboard appears. • Clearer connection and file transfer status throughout the app. • A new Lock Screen widget for quickly opening VVTerm on iPhone. • Connections now open without an extra Pro upgrade screen. • Additional reliability fixes for server stats, tmux sessions, tabs, and settings.

  • 2.6

    Version 2.6 focuses on reliability across Mac, iPhone, and iPad. • New storage details and health checks—including BTRFS and ZFS arrays—with per-volume visibility controls and clearer warnings. • A new Keep Screen Awake setting, enabled by default. • Major improvements to the iPhone and iPad software keyboard. • Faster, more reliable SSH, Mosh, and tmux connections and recovery, including repair for broken Mosh installations. • Improved direct-touch mouse input and hardware-key repeat. • Stability fixes for macOS server stats, voice input, Live Activities, background sessions, and iPad windowing.

  • 2.8

    Version 2.8 improves Mosh reliability and terminal input on iPhone and iPad. • Mosh sessions now stay connected when switching apps or briefly losing network access. • Fixed blank terminal content and missing prompts after returning to VVTerm. • Fixed keyboard and toolbar recovery, including immediate Keyboard and Voice Input controls after dismissal. • Mosh fallback diagnostics can now be expanded and copied when troubleshooting.

  • 2.9

    • Added Eternal Terminal support for more resilient remote sessions. • Terminal tabs and resumable sessions now return after app relaunch, with better Mosh recovery. • Added complete keyboard controls for split panes and terminal font zoom on iPad and Mac. • Improved iPad keyboard input, Zen Mode, connection dialogs, terminal colors and sizing, image rendering, and dashboard layouts.
